Matthew Morgan: Proper Pub
Change is a strange force — some welcome it, some don’t. Things change, but the memory of the past still fuels this proper Cornish pub.
From March 2023 to April 2024 I immersed myself in documenting the story of the Seaview Inn, its customers, and the transitions in its management. This project has connected me deeply with the community that frequents the Seaview Inn. My goal to paint a vivid picture of what a small Cornish pub nestled along the South coast embodies and represents. Capturing the true essence of sitting at the bar, drink in hand, and immersing oneself in the authentic atmosphere of a traditional pub. It has illuminated my perspective on the place I’ve called home for the past three years and the people with whom I share it. Despite the passing of time, the spirit of the local Cornish community endures, particularly in places like the Seaview Inn, overlooking Falmouth Bay. I feel incredibly fortunate to have had the opportunity to document this establishment and to feel a valued member of the Seaview Inn community.
From the moment I first walked through the door, I felt an instant sense of ease, as if I had been there before. An air of nostalgia permeated the interior, transporting me back to childhood holidays in Cornwall, walking into a pub with my parents. Memories of sipping a Coke, learning to play pool, and sneaking a taste of my dad’s beer flooded back. The Inn, formerly known as Zion Manor, dates back to the 1800s. It was once owned by a wealthy shipowner, and the front of the manor featured a sloping garden now known as The Lawn. A pathway once led directly down to a quay by what is now Bosuns Locker Chandlery, where the shipowner docked his vessels to load and unload cargo, which was then carried up to storage sheds behind the manor. Over time, the manor was divided into two dwellings: Dolphin House and the pub known as the Seaview Inn.
My initial visit to the pub was sparked by curiosity about the Seaview Old Boys cricket team, a pub team I had heard about while playing for Falmouth Cricket Club. Stories of the strong sense of community within the team intrigued me. In March 2023, I arranged to meet Da-mo, the captain of the Seaview Old Boys, to discuss documenting and following the team throughout the summer. With no expectations and an open mind, I discovered something special about the Seaview Inn. It is a hub, a community, a place where people gather to socialise, relax, and have fun.
Documenting the Seaview Inn has certainly raised eyebrows and sparked curiosity. Some people were puzzled by someone walking around with a camera, interacting with customers, and capturing moments. But with each visit, the community’s understanding and acceptance grow. Now, arriving without my camera feels wrong. People ask if I ever leave it behind, to which I respond: don’t be daft.
